Output d628d4c83addfc96248f11c7a7cd2005181a67e6626c51ebda627487a2512d0a:0

value
10000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ff0cc8e6e58659eab13424dc9284e76d2825cf3 OP_EQUALVERIFY OP_CHECKSIG
address
18HgrAcjciJc5pNRsJ4YfZvHKkfpgkT6rk
transaction
d628d4c83addfc96248f11c7a7cd2005181a67e6626c51ebda627487a2512d0a
confirmations
538301
spent
true